ATM/Debit On-line Authorization Issuer System for Core Systems

Debit card transaction volumes are poised to surpass credit card transactions making the need to access on-line balances extremely important to reduce a financial institution's exposure to fraudulent activity and overdrawn accounts. This processing environment consists of a u/SWITCHWARE issuer system that provides connectivity to an ATM/Debit transaction acquirer (i.e., network) and an on-line interface to a core system.

Diebold PACE Emulation Solution

In cases where a financial institution has a legacy core system that supports a Diebold PACE message format, u/SWITCHWARE can emulate the Diebold PACE system saving costly changes to the legacy core system.

POS Transaction Processing and Merchant Accounting
 
A Point-Of-Sale (POS) module can additionally be deployed for POS terminal support and transaction acquiring. The POS module also includes a merchant file for accounting, reporting and settlement.

Middleware System
 
Situated between a core banking system and a front-end delivery system, u/SWITCHWARE can be used to interface the two systems when a common interface cannot otherwise be achieved. u/SWITCHWARE receives the incoming message, logs it and converts the incoming message format to a message format supported by the backend system.

Customized Payment Processing
 
u/SWITCHWARE can also be used to meet the needs of business who have special payment application needs. As an example, u/SWITCHWARE has become a popularly used payment processing application for scrap collection yards who desired to automate their scrap delivery and payment procedures. This special implementation provides cash payments from ATMs eliminating the need for a secure cashier's window. Payments and the corresponding scrap purchases can be matched promptly.
